Richard Fran Biegenwald (August 24, 1940 – March 10, 2008) was an American serial killer and arsonist who murdered six people, four women and two men, in Monmouth County, New Jersey, between 1958 and 1983. He is suspected in at least two other murders.

    The Asbury Park Press, formerly known as the Shore Press, Daily Press, Asbury Park Daily Press, and Asbury Park Evening Press, is the thrid largest daily newspaper in the state of New Jersey. [1] Established in 1879, it has been owned by Gannett since 1997. [2] The newspaper is part of the USA Today Network.

    Amabile coached at Neptune High School from 1985 to 2000. From 1993 to 1999, the Scarlet Fliers had a 33-game home winning streak. From 1994 to 1998, Neptune won five straight Shore Conference divisional titles, going unbeaten in 1995 and 1997. [5] From 2003 to 2008, Amabile coached St. John Vianney.

August 20, 1891 – August 1984) was an American polar explorer, submariner and aviation pioneer. He was born in Bradley Beach, New Jersey and raised in Neptune Township, New Jersey where he attended Neptune High School. [1][2]
